PROFESSIONAL DUTIES OF A TEACHER
A teacher who is not a principal shall carry out the professional duties of a teacher as circumstances may require:
1. If he/she is employed as a teacher in a school under the reasonable direction of the principal of that school;
2. If he/she is employed by a board on terms under which he is not assigned to any one school, under the reasonable direction of that board and of the principal of any school in which he/she may for the time being be required to work as a teacher.
Responsibilities include:
1. Planning and preparing courses and lessons;
2. Teaching, according to their educational needs, the pupils assigned to him/her, including the setting and marking of work to be carried out by the pupils in school and elsewhere;
3. Assessing, recording and reporting on the development, progress and attainment of pupils;
4. Promoting the general progress and well-being of individual pupils and of any class or group of pupils assigned to him/her;
5. Providing advice and guidance to pupils on educational and social matters and on their further education and future careers;
6. Making records of and reports on the personal and social needs of pupils;
7. Communicating and consulting with the parents of pupils;
8. Participating in meetings arranged for any of the purposes described above;
9. Maintaining good order and discipline among pupils in accordance with the policies of the employing authority;
10. Participating in arrangements for preparing pupils for public examinations and in assessing pupils for the purposes of such examinations;
11. Contributing to the selection for appointment and professional development of other teachers;
12. Participating in administrative and organisational tasks related to such duties.
Minimum Requirements:
1. Hold a teaching qualification which meets the requirements for recognition to teach in grant-aided schools in Northern Ireland at the closing date for completed applications.
2. Hold a degree of a minimum 2:2.
3. Demonstrate at least 1 year’s experience of teaching students at Key Stage 2 and/or Key Stage 3.
4. Be registered with the General Teaching Council for Northern Ireland (GTCNI) before taking up post.
